b. Information Collected Using Cookies and other Web Technologies

Like many website owners and operators, we use automated data collection tools such as Cookies and Web Beacons to collect certain information on our Site.

Cookies” are small text files that are placed on your hard drive by a Web server when you (or your authorized child) access our Service. We may use both session Cookies and persistent Cookies to identify that you (or your authorized child) have logged in to the Service and to tell us how and when you (or your authorized child) interact with our Service. We may also use Cookies to monitor aggregate usage and web traffic routing on our Service and to customize and improve our Service. Session Cookies are deleted when you (or your authorized child) log off from the Service and close the browser. Persistent Cookies remain on your computer and will identify how you use the Service over time. Although most browsers automatically accept Cookies, you can change your browser options to stop automatically accepting Cookies or to prompt you before accepting Cookies. Please note, however, that if you don’t accept Cookies, you (or your authorized child) may not be able to access all portions or features of the Service. Some third party Service providers that we engage (including third party advertisers) may also place their own Cookies on your hard drive.

Web Beacons” (also known as web bugs, pixel tags, or clear GIFs) are tiny graphics with a unique identifier that may be included on our Service for several purposes. For example, we may use Web Beacons to deliver or communicate with Cookies, to track and measure the performance of our Service, to monitor how many visitors view our Service, and to monitor the effectiveness of our advertising. Unlike Cookies, which are stored on the user’s hard drive, Web Beacons are typically embedded invisibly on web pages (or in an e-mail).
